USGS Hydrosheds ADF does not match coordinate system

OK here is the problem

I have a Civil3D file with Drawing Settings = WGS84 UTM-Zone44 North

Map3D coordinate system = WGS84 UTM-Zone44 North

a USGS DEM from HYDROsheds data set (tile = N40E80) also note  this DEM is a folder of multiple ADF files

 

when using FDO provider the DEM comes in just fine but it lands in the wrong location thousands of kilometers away.

 

When I load the same shape files into ArcMAP10 with spatial reference as WGS84 UTM-Zone44 North everything lines up perfectly.

 

so how do I make it come into Map3D correctly???

Sounds like Map/Civil isn't reading the CS properly.  Just use the Edit coordinates option to assign the correct CS (it may or may not be the UTM that you are using for the drawing - you'll need to find that out).  Once it's assigned properly, the transformation will happen automatically to the CS of the drawing.editC.png
